Iron ore prices 'could drop 30pc'

Credit Suisse analysts are more bullish on iron ore than most – they also expect prices to fall, but not suddenly.

Although iron ore's price gains defied predictions in 2016, many analysts now believe new supply, high inventories, and insufficient demand are setting iron ore up for sharp losses in the second half of this year.

Australian Snap investor makes billions

The very first investor in what would become Snap was an Australian living in the US, whose initial $641,000 on behalf of his firm Lightspeed eventually led to billions in gains.
